Output 54ca214ecde868fbf9a92c20893b4be9e7b0abb768e5b55e4ff7e7120cd79c99:1

value
612309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5be3b04df118a804a419edd7af871937d08f0e4d OP_EQUAL
address
3A4tB63cKc5ZWpnxji78LxrM4F5mh35M6k
transaction
54ca214ecde868fbf9a92c20893b4be9e7b0abb768e5b55e4ff7e7120cd79c99
confirmations
393663
spent
true